Ingredients for Ina Garten Basil Pesto Recipe

Complete Ingredient List with Measurements

  • 2 cups fresh basil leaves, packed
  • 1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1/3 cup pine nuts (toasted if desired)
  • 3 medium-sized cloves of garlic, minced
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Substitutes and Alternatives
If you have dietary restrictions or simply don’t have certain ingredients on hand, don’t worry! You can substitute the pine nuts with walnuts or almonds for a different flavor profile. Additionally, if you’re lactose intolerant, nutritional yeast can provide a cheesy flavor without the dairy.

For those seeking a nut-free option, simply omit the nuts or choose pumpkin seeds as an alternative. This gives you that lovely texture while accommodating allergies or intolerances.

How to Make Ina Garten Basil Pesto Recipe – Step-by-Step Directions

Step 1 – Prepare Ingredients

Start by washing the fresh basil leaves thoroughly to remove any dirt. Once clean, gently p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el. Gathering all your ingredients in one place makes the next steps easier.

Step 2 – Toast the Nuts (Optional)

If you’d like, toast the pine nuts in a skillet over medium heat for about 3-4 minutes. Toss them frequently until they are golden brown to enhance their flavor. Be careful not to burn them.

Step 3 – Blend Basil and Garlic

In a food processor, combine the packed basil leaves and minced garlic. Pulse until the mixture consists of finely chopped herbs. This initial step releases the oils and enhances the overall flavor.

Step 4 – Add Nuts and Cheese

Next, add your toasted pine nuts and freshly grated Parmesan cheese to the processor. Pulse again until well combined and all ingredients are finely chopped.

Step 5 – Pour in Olive Oil

With the processor running, slowly pour the olive oil into the mixture. Continue blending until the pesto achieves a smooth consistency. You may need to scrape down the sides of the bowl to ensure even mixing.

Step 6 – Season to Taste

Once your pesto is blended, taste it! Add salt and freshly ground black pepper to your liking. This step is crucial as it pulls all the flavors together.

Step 7 – Strain (If Desired)

If you prefer a thinner consistency, you can strain the pesto through a fine-mesh sieve. However, many enjoy the robust texture without straining.

Step 8 – Store

Transfer the finished pesto into an airtight container. If you plan to store it, drizzle a thin layer of olive oil on top to prevent browning. Seal tightly and store in the fridge.

Step 9 – Use or Freeze

Enjoy your Ina Garten Basil Pesto right away, or freeze it for later. Portion it into ice cube trays for easy use in the future.

How to Store Ina Garten Basil Pesto Recipe Properly

Best Storage Practices
To keep your basil pesto fresh,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week. Adding a thin layer of olive oil on top can help preserve its vibrant green color by limiting exposure to air. Always store it away from strong odors in the fridge to prevent flavor absorption.

Reheating and Freezing Tips
If you have leftover pesto, you can freeze it for up to three months. Pour pesto into ice cube trays, freeze until solid, and then transfer the cubes to a freezer-safe bag. When you need a quick meal, simply thaw the desired amount in the fridge overnight or briefly heat it in the microwave.

Tips & Tricks for Ina Garten Basil Pesto Recipe

Mistakes to Avoid
1 – Over-processing: If you blend the ingredients too long, you’ll lose the desirable texture and end up with a paste rather than a suitable pesto consistency.
2 – Ignoring fresh ingredients: Using stale or less-than-fresh basil can result in a less vibrant flavor. Always choose the freshest herbs available.
3 – Skipping seasoning: Tasting your pesto before storing ensures you’ll have that perfect balance of flavors. Don’t overlook this step!
4 – Using too much oil: Adding too much olive oil can make the pesto greasy. Start with a smaller amount and adjust to your desired consistency.
5 – Not being creative: Experimentation is key! Don’t be afraid to swap out ingredients based on your taste preferences or what you have available.

Extra Tips for Better Results
To elevate the flavor of your pesto even further, try using a mix of basil and arugula or spinach for an added peppery kick. You can also try different types of cheese, such as Pecorino Romano, for a sharper taste. Fresh lemon juice can brighten the overall flavor and help balance the richness of the cheese and nuts.

Recipe Variations of Ina Garten Basil Pesto Recipe

Creative Twists
1 – Spinach Pesto: Combine fresh spinach with basil for a milder flavor that’s equally delicious. This variation is great for sneaking in extra greens!
2 – Avocado Pesto: Adding ripe avocado creates a creamy texture, making this version perfect for spreading on sandwiches or topping salads.
3 – Sun-Dried Tomato Pesto: Blend in sun-dried tomatoes for a tangy, earthy flavor. This is particularly wonderful when tossed with pasta.
4 – Vegan Pesto: By omitting the cheese and substituting with nutritional yeast, you can create a vegan-friendly option that retains the umami flavor.

Dietary Adjustments
For those avoiding gluten, using this basil pesto sauce on gluten-free pasta or grain bowls can provide a flavorful and safe meal. If you’re dairy-free, stick to the substitutes listed earlier to keep the flavor intact while meeting dietary needs.
